Job Summary
The community division of Mass General Brigham is seeking experienced Primary Care physicians to join our newly forming Float team. Float physicians are not responsible for attributed patients; rather, this flexible, dynamic role offers short-term panel management coverage for clinicians on leave and patients without established care. This is an ideal opportunity for physicians who thrive on caring for diverse patient populations across a variety of practice settings.
Key Highlights :
- Flexible Role : Ideal for physicians seeking variety in their practice, with the ability to travel throughout the Greater Boston area.
- Support : You'll work closely with a supportive team for in-basket coverage and have streamlined access to specialists across the Mass General Brigham network, including Brigham and Women's and Massachusetts General Hospital.
- Career Growth : Access to ongoing medical education, career development resources, and competitive salary and benefits.
